Investment Philosophy and Risk Management
Somrutai Sangchaiphum emphasizes a blend of value investing and disciplined risk controls. The approach favors businesses with strong moats, healthy balance sheets, and transparent governance, which helps reduce tail risk during market stress.
Position sizing follows strict rules, avoiding overexposure to any single issuer or sector. Regular portfolio reviews and clear stop loss criteria ensure that deviations are corrected early, protecting capital while allowing winners to compound.

Asset Allocation and Portfolio Composition
Current allocations tilt toward large cap Thai names, selectively diversified into ASEAN equity exposure and high quality fixed income. The mix is designed to balance local insight with regional diversification, reducing country specific idiosyncrasies.
Alternative allocations to private equity and infrastructure are kept meaningful but controlled, ensuring liquidity needs are met while capturing long term structural growth. Regular rebalancing preserves the intended risk profile as markets evolve.
Key Takeaways and Recommended Actions
- Define a written investment policy that specifies target asset mix, risk limits, and review frequency.
- Prioritize businesses with strong balance sheets, recurring revenue, and transparent management communication.
- Use core satellite allocation to combine low cost broad exposure with concentrated insight positions.
- Rebalance systematically to maintain target risk and avoid emotional drift during volatile periods.
- Track metrics like Sharpe ratio, maximum drawdown, and sector drift to evaluate process quality.
